使用mysqladmin检测MySQL运行状态的教程
mysqladmin是MySQL一个重要的客户端,最常见的是使用它来关闭数据库,除此,该命令还可以了解MySQL运行状态、进程信息、进程杀死等。本文介绍一下如何使用mysqladmin extended-status(因为没有"歧义",所以可以使用ext代替)了解MySQL的运行状态。
1. 使用-r/-i参数
使用mysqladmin extended-status命令可以获得所有MySQL性能指标,即show global status的输出,不过,因为多数这些指标都是累计值,如果想了解当前的状态,则需要进行一次差值计算,这就是mysqladmin extended-status的一个额外功能,非常实用。默认的,使用extended-status,看到也是累计值,但是,加上参数-r(--relative),就可以看到各个指标的差值,配合参数-i(--sleep)就可以指定刷新的频率,那么就有如下命令:
?
1 2 3 4 5 6 7 8 9 10 |
|
2. 配合grep使用
配合grep使用,我们就有:
?
1 2 3 4 5 6 7 8 9 10 11 12 13 |
|
3. 配合简单的awk使用
使用awk,同时输出时间信息:
?
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 |
|
4. 配合复杂一点的awk
反正也不简单了,那就更复杂一点,这样让输出结果更友好点,因为awk不支持动态变量,所以代码看起来比较复杂:
?
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 |
|
就这样了,这几个命令自己用的比较多,随手分享出来。
使用mysqladmin检测MySQL运行状态的教程相关推荐
- mysqladmin检测MySQL运行状态
执行命令: mysqladmin -uroot -pXX ping 显示以下结果为正常: mysqld is alive mysqladmin检测MySQL运行状态脚本: #!/bin/bash ho ...
- (转)使用mysqladmin ext了解MySQL运行状态
来源:http://www.jb51.net/article/48169.htm mysqladmin是MySQL一个重要的客户端,最常见的是使用它来关闭数据库,除此,该命令还可以了解MySQL运行状 ...
- linux mysql 运行状态_Linux中使用mysqladmin extended-status配合Linux命令查看MySQL运行状态...
mysqladmin是MySQL一个重要的客户端,最常见的是使用它来关闭数据库,除此,该命令还可以了解MySQL运行状态.进程信息.进程杀死等.本文介绍一下如何使用mysqladmin extende ...
- 企业版mysql安装教程linux,linux上mysql安装详细教程
所有平台的MySQL下载地址为: MySQL 下载. 挑选你需要的 MySQL Community Server 版本及对应的平台. MySQL - MySQL服务器.你需要该选项,除非你只想连接运行 ...
- centos得mysql安装教程_Centos下Mysql安装图文教程_MySQL
Mysql是比较常用的数据库,日常开发中也是采用地比较多.工欲善其事必先利其器,本文特地来讲解下如何在centos(其他linux发行版类似)下安装Mysql.首先准备的材料:Mysql,我这里采用的 ...
- MySQL 快速入门教程
转:MySQL快速 入门教程 目录 一.MySQL的相关概念介绍 二.Windows下MySQL的配置 配置步骤 MySQL服务的启动.停止与卸载 三.MySQL脚本的基本组成 四.MySQL中的数据 ...
- MySQL Workbench 使用教程 - 如何使用 Workbench 操作 MySQL / MariaDB 数据库中文指南
MySQL Workbench 是一款专门为 MySQL 设计的可视化数据库管理软件,我们可以在自己的计算机上,使用图形化界面远程管理 MySQL 数据库. 有关 MySQL 远程管理软件,你可以选择 ...
- [转]OS X Mountain Lion 系统配置 Apache+Mysql+PHP 详细教程
OS X Mountain Lion 系统配置 Apache+Mysql+PHP 详细教程 [转][url]http://www.guomii.com/posts/30136[/url] 如果你是一名 ...
- Linux环境安装mysql数据库详细教程(含卸载和密码重置过程)
本教程适用于centos7/8,mysql 5.x 1.卸载mysql(重要) 在安装mysql之前要确保自己的系统中没有mysql,即使你是刚刚重装的系统或者是刚购买的云服务,也需要检查一下是否存在 ...
最新文章
- 创建一个栈存储结构,并且写入一些对栈的基本的操作
- xp计算机管理窗口,我的xp系统在“打开”窗口中没有“我的电脑”一项,只有界面、我的文档和界面,怎办?...
- java 创建日程到期提醒_苹果“快捷指令”日程播报完美版
- 计算机组成原理译码器选择,计算机组成原理第三章习题参考解析.doc
- 盘点优秀程序员的六大特征
- Android 多选列表
- php 后期发展,php面对对象之后期绑定
- Splunk企业级运维智能大数据分析平台新手入门视频课程上线
- html 怎么设置时间函数,JavaScript日期函数 - 计时器、innerHTML
- 公司绝不会告诉你的20大秘密 转载
- leetcode[232]用栈实现队列/Implement Queue using Stacks
- Lucas(卢卡斯)定理---组合数取模问题
- 移动端一倍图,二倍图尺寸
- java hypot_java.lang.StrictMath.hypot()方法实例
- 冒泡排序和纯指针的冒泡排序
- 5种方法完美解决android软键盘挡住输入框方法详解
- 安卓六大平台开发者注册地址和方法链接
- maya模型切割工具插件 tjh_Cut_Tool 1.2.0 下载及教程
- Mac 如何连接远程服务器
- 中国文艺复兴_2040年即将到来的文艺复兴
热门文章
- MBA-day22 至多至少问题
- Tiny语言编译器简介
- 轴承轮廓测量解决方案
- 中国 IM 企业的新机会?揭秘融云全球通信云网络背后的技术 | 对话 WICC
- 内容对齐 TextAlignment VerticalAlignment HorizontalAlignment contentMode
- pytorch 状态字典:state_dict
- 用source函数代替繁冗的R语言打包过程
- 锁相环(PLL)基本结构及相关基本知识
- event-log-tags
- 实验三十五 Windows Server 2012 RDS桌面虚拟化之六VDI虚拟桌面的用户管理和安全防护